Nonetheless, the process has a number of very interesting properties, … every bts mv playing at the same timeNettet12. sep. 2024 · We address the theory of records for integrated random walks with finite variance. The long-time continuum limit of these walks is a non-Markov process known as the random acceleration process or the integral of Brownian motion.
